Thompson, located in the northeastern corner of Connecticut, borders Massachusetts and Rhode Island, offering a rural atmosphere characterized by woodlands, parks and country roads. The town is known for its quiet appeal and Marianapolis Preparatory School, a highly regarded Catholic high school with rigorous academics. Housing in Thompson varies, with options ranging from ranch-style, split-level and Cape Cod homes to Colonial and modern transitional styles. Build dates range from the 1800s and the 2020s. Waterfront properties, particularly those near Quaddick Reservoir, are among the priciest and most sought-after. Thompson offers several attractions, including the Thompson Speedway Motorsports Park, which hosts NASCAR events, and the Air Line State Park Trail, a multi-use path ideal for hiking. Quaddick State Park provides opportunities for fishing, boating and ice skating, while Riverside Park features basketball and softball facilities. For dining, ANYA is a local favorite for gourmet meals, and nearby Putnam offers additional shopping and dining options, including antique stores and restaurants like 85 Main and The Hare & the Hound. Thompson is car-dependent, with Interstate 395 providing access to Worcester, Massachusetts, located about 25 miles away. The town's rural charm and proximity to both Massachusetts and Rhode Island make it an attractive location for homebuyers seeking a quieter lifestyle.
